There is no way to get a chip to work on these newer vehicles. It's a PCM reprogram or nothing.
If you want to stick with the 3100 and are wanting power, here's your options:
Larger TB* Intake Spacers* Cam Regrind* PCM S&S Headers 2.5" DP (I wouldn't go 3" on 3100) Ubend Delete Underdrive Pulley
Or the above, except remove S&S headers/DP and substitute:
TGP Exhaust Manifolds GT28 Turbo Custom 3" DP
*Available from 60degreev6.com store.
